#include <common/optional.h>
#include <lttng/action/action-internal.h>
#include <lttng/action/group.h>
+#include <lttng/action/notify-internal.h>
#include <lttng/action/notify.h>
#include <lttng/action/rotate-session.h>
#include <lttng/action/snapshot-session.h>
#include <lttng/action/start-session.h>
#include <lttng/action/stop-session.h>
#include <lttng/condition/evaluation.h>
-#include <lttng/condition/event-rule-internal.h>
+#include <lttng/condition/on-event-internal.h>
#include <lttng/lttng-error.h>
#include <lttng/trigger/trigger-internal.h>
#include <pthread.h>
const struct lttng_action *action)
{
return notification_client_list_send_evaluation(work_item->client_list,
- lttng_trigger_get_const_condition(work_item->trigger),
+ work_item->trigger,
work_item->evaluation,
- lttng_trigger_get_credentials(work_item->trigger),
work_item->object_creds.is_set ?
&(work_item->object_creds.value) :
NULL,